These are the five best movies on TV for your Wednesday night in

Rory Cashin

Some rom-coms, some thrillers, and one of the best documentaries in ages.

Welcome to Wednesday, and welcome to your Wednesday movie selection!

PS I Love You – Comedy Central – 9pm

A young widow (Hilary Swank) discovers that her late husband (Gerard Butler) has left her 10 messages intended to help ease her pain and start a new life.

Four Weddings and a Funeral – FilmFour – 9pm

Over the course of five social occasions, a committed bachelor (Hugh Grant) must consider the notion that he may have discovered love.

Tina – Sky One – 10pm

A new documentary on the legendary Tina Turner, featuring exclusive access to the artist, and a deep dive on her career and personal life to date.

Cop Land – ITV4 – 10.10pm

The Sheriff (Sylvester Stallone) of a suburban New Jersey community, populated by New York City police officers, slowly discovers the town is a front for mob connections and corruption.

Tangerine – FilmFour – 11.20pm

A hooker (Kitana Kiki Rodriguez) tears through Tinseltown on Christmas Eve searching for the pimp (James Ransone) who broke her heart.
